About the Book

Need Some Cheering Up? Look Inside… Looking at the bright side takes some work during a pandemic, but Esther does her best. In this latest collection of stories, the author mostly turns to the pre-COVID past and shares a unique, often comic take on her life’s happenings. The stories travel from her creative world of art and writing, to the home front, to her growing up and mothering years, and more. Rounding out the collection are poems from her sons, Larry and David, and ways to connect to her creative grandchildren, Julian Roc, a musician with music videos on YouTube, and Krystal Pearl, a member of the cheer team of the NFL's Los Angeles Chargers with exercise videos on YouTube. Join Esther and her family for a lighter view of life during these challenging times.


About the Author

Esther Pearlman is a writer, artist, wife, mother, friend and much more! She believes we all should give ourselves a hug for riding out this pesky COVID-19. She and her husband Marty live in Santa Monica, California, where she loves to photograph strangers walking by to use as a basis for her portraits—wearing her mask and keeping her social distance, of course! Esther believes the best is yet to come. Her clever and lively artwork illustrates this book, including the cover.
